For several years, organizations have been operating in an unprecedented labor environment. Between “The Great Resignation,” historically low unemployment rates and an environment of fierce competition, there is no doubt that we are operating in a job seeker’s market. These disruptive forces are fundamentally changing the way organizations think about work and the workforce, and that situation is not expected to reverse anytime soon. The best way for organizations to respond is by creating the right kind of stand-out, magnetic culture that attracts and retains top talent.
